【视频】Vuepress 搭建个人文档网站 GitHub Actions/GitHub Pages 免费资源用到饱
这个视频其实我很早就录了,当时都还没阳。录制的过程中出现了一个问题,折腾很久才解决。所以中间必须补录一段,剪接拼贴,所以一直拖到现在。
我在安装依赖的时候,按照习惯,使用 pnpm i vuepress@^2.0.0-beta.53,希望安装当时最新的 2.0.0-beta.53 版本,并且声明对后续版本的支持,只要大版本保持一致,可以接受小版本升级。
但是实际安装的时候,不知道是什么原因,pnpm 给我装了一堆不合适的插件。(我怀疑跟 beta 有关),导致启动开发环境后白屏,报告一堆莫名其妙的错误。最后我把环境清空,从头开始配置,仔细看各种输出才猜出来。
期间浪费了 40 分钟,我觉得直接放出来纯属浪费大家的时间,所以一直没有上传。前几天终于下定决心补录,并且处理了字幕,才最终上传。
这则视频里介绍了:
- 使用 Vuepress 生成静态文档站
- 使用 GitHub Actions 执行特定的工作流程,在 master 更新后执行
pnpm run build - 然后把生成的
dist目录推送到新的分支,避免/docs污染代码仓库 - 利用域名 CNAME 突破科学上网的封锁,利用免费资源拥有自己的网站
希望这段视频对大家有用。如果你有静态网站构建需求,或者想使用免费线上资源简历自己的网站,都可以学习这个视频。如果你有其它问题、意见、或建议,也欢迎评论留言。请看到的同学帮忙一键三连、完播、转发,谢谢。
相关文章
SSR,云平台,ChatGPT——我的 2023 技术关键词
前言 2023 年,因为换工作,启动新项目等原因,我对我的技术栈进行了比较大的更新,主要集中在这三个方向: 接 […]
2024-01-078 分钟
【视频】使用 pnpm workspace 管理 monorepo
有些时候,一个产品由多个不同的项目组成。它们虽然可以独立发布,但彼此之间存在很强的版本依赖关系。这个时候,使用 […]
2023-05-102 分钟
【视频】肉山的模拟面试系列(三):在校生杨秋实同学
模拟面试系列继续,进入第三周,这次请到的是杨秋实(化名)同学。(这周参加一场 Hackathon,基本上一周都 […]
2023-02-191 分钟


